Entry-Level Veterinary Technologist and Technician Salary in Eagan, MN: $39,164 (2026)
Quick Answer:New veterinary technologists and technicians entering the Eagan, MN job market in 2026 can expect a starting salary around $39,164 (BLS 10th-percentile benchmark for SOC 29-2056, projected from 2025 OEWS data). Stripping out Eagan's local price level (BEA RPP 98.5 — 1% below national), a first-year paycheck buys what $39,760 would in average-cost America. Most reach the city median ($50,120) within a few years of clinical practice.

Vet Tech Salary Negotiation Tips for New Graduates in Eagan
- 1Research the Eagan market: entry-level veterinary technologist and technician pay ranges from $39,164 to $41,827, so aim for at least the 25th percentile if you have strong credentials.
- 2Highlight any additional certifications or specialty training within the veterinary technology field — employers in MN often pay a premium for expanded scope of work.
- 3Evaluate the full compensation package — in Eagan, benefits like health insurance, continuing-education allowances, and schedule flexibility can add 20-30% to your effective compensation.
- 4Consider starting with a larger hospital system or multi-site employer in Eagan for competitive entry-level pay and structured mentorship, then move to a smaller employer once you have 2-3 years of experience.
- 5Eagan's moderate cost of living means your starting salary goes further here compared to many larger metro areas.

Starting Your veterinary technology Career in Eagan
Employers in Eagan actively recruit new graduates, primarily from general practice clinics that provide essential on-the-job training and supervision. Corporate entities like VCA and BluePearl are also excellent options, often offering structured mentorship programs, sign-on bonuses, and an inclusive environment for newcomers. To maximize earning potential right out of school, aspiring veterinary technicians should focus on obtaining credentials from AVMA CVTEA-accredited programs, passing the VTNE, and securing state credentials like CVT, RVT, or LVT. Additionally, pursuing advanced credentials like the VTS specialty can lead to pay substantially exceeding starting rates, with top-tier professionals earning between $30-$45+ per hour. As the veterinary technician workforce shortage persists—having spurred pay increases of 25-40% in many markets since 2020—new grads can realistically anticipate their salaries moving upward as they gain experience in Eagan's evolving job market.
